Installation
Installation is in the reverse order of removal.
Pay attention to the following points:
• Apply bond to the mating surface of the breather
cover.
: Sealant 99000–31110 (SUZUKI BOND
No.1215 or equivalent)
NOTE
• Make surfaces free from moisture, oil, dust
and other foreign materials.
• Spread the sealant on surfaced thinly to
form an even layer, and assembly the
crankcases within a few minutes.
• Fit the breather cover (1) and tighten the bolts.
• Connect the PCV hose (2) securely.

Crankcase Breather (PCV) Cover Inspection

Inspect the crankcase breather (PCV) cover in the
following procedures.
1) Remove the crankcase breather cover. Refer to
"Crankcase Breather (PCV) Hose / Cover /
Separator Removal and Installation (Page 1B-8)".
2) Inspect the crankcase breather cover in the carbon
deposit. If the carbon deposit is found in the
crankcase breather cover, remove it.
I718H1120040-03
3) Reinstall the crankcase breather cover. Refer to
"Crankcase Breather (PCV) Hose / Cover /
Separator Removal and Installation (Page 1B-8)".
